Sorts Of Irrigation Systems: An Introduction



Irrigation systems been available in various kinds, each designed to fulfill specific horticulture requirements and conditions. The most typical types consist of surface Irrigation, which includes water moving over the soil surface area, and is often used in huge farming settings. Trickle Irrigation delivers water directly to the plant origins with a network of tubes and emitters, however details on its advantages will certainly be covered later. Automatic sprinkler disperse water with a collection of pipelines and spray heads, resembling natural rainfall and ideal for numerous garden sizes. Subsurface Irrigation, where water is provided below the dirt surface area, is effective in conserving water and minimizing dissipation. Lastly, manual watering, while labor-intensive, enables precise control over water application. Each system has its restrictions and benefits, making it crucial for gardeners to assess their particular demands prior to selecting.


Drip Irrigation: Considerations and advantages



Leak Irrigation stands out as a reliable approach for delivering water straight to the origins of plants, making it a preferred choice for many gardeners. This system lessens water waste by minimizing evaporation and overflow, enabling for exact water application where it is required most. This targeted technique not only conserves water however likewise advertises much healthier plant growth by avoiding waterlogging and minimizing weed growth.


One more advantage of drip Irrigation is its versatility to various garden formats and plant kinds. Whether in elevated beds, containers, or traditional rows, this system can be personalized to fit individual requirements. Nevertheless, there are factors to consider to remember. First setup prices can be more than traditional techniques, and upkeep is necessary to avoid blocking of emitters. Furthermore, gardeners need to check soil moisture degrees to ensure ideal Irrigation. Eventually, drip Irrigation offers substantial advantages for those aiming to boost their horticulture performance.

For gardeners looking for an alternative to trickle Irrigation, sprinkler systems provide a preferred option, offering special benefits and downsides. One substantial benefit is their ability to cover large locations promptly, making them appropriate for expansive gardens or grass. Automatic sprinkler can likewise be automated, supplying benefit and guaranteeing consistent watering timetables. Nonetheless, they may bring about water waste due to dissipation and wind drift, particularly in warm, completely dry environments.


In addition, sprinklers can add to fungal illness by moistening vegetation, which may be harmful to plant wellness. The first installation expense can be greater contrasted to less complex systems, and maintenance may be needed to protect against clogs and ensure peak efficiency. Inevitably, gardeners should consider these disadvantages and pros to establish if lawn sprinkler align with their specific watering needs and garden conditions. Careful consideration will lead to more effective Irrigation options that sustain healthy and balanced plant development.

Setup Tips and Techniques



When planning to install soaker pipes in a garden, appropriate strategies can noticeably boost water efficiency and plant health. To start with, garden enthusiasts should lay the hose pipes along the base of plants, guaranteeing they are close to the origin area for maximum absorption. It is recommended to set up the tubes in a serpentine pattern to cover more area while reducing water waste. The installation needs to include a pressure regulatory authority to maintain constant water circulation. Furthermore, protecting the hoses with risks or yard pins can prevent them from kinking or relocating. Gardeners need to also inspect for any kind of obstructions, such as weeds or debris, while making certain the hose pipe is not hidden also deeply in the soil, enabling reliable moisture distribution.


Maintenance and Treatment Guidelines



Routine upkeep is important for making best use of the longevity and performance of soaker hoses in any type of yard. Gardeners must routinely look for blockages and tidy the hose pipes to ensure suitable water circulation. Flushing the hoses with a solution of vinegar and water can assist eliminate mineral down payments. Furthermore, it is important to inspect the hoses for leaks or damage, replacing any defective sections quickly. During winter season, tubes must be drained, rolled up, and stored in a dry location to prevent cold and fracturing. Garden enthusiasts ought to monitor the soil dampness levels to adjust the watering frequency, ensuring that the soaker hoses provide appropriate wetness without over-saturating the soil. Correct treatment will certainly improve the efficiency and lifespan of soaker tubes.

Tips for Optimizing Your Watering Practices

Several garden enthusiasts concentrate on picking the ideal Irrigation system, enhancing watering methods is similarly vital for promoting healthy plant growth. Timing is vital; sprinkling early in the early morning or late at night lessens dissipation and enables plants to take in moisture efficiently. Additionally, utilizing compost around plants can help retain dirt moisture and regulate temperature, lowering the demand for constant watering.


It is additionally important to keep an eye on climate condition regularly. Rain can lower the demand for extra watering, and changing schedules accordingly can preserve water. Using soil moisture sensors can provide beneficial understandings right into when and just how much to water, ensuring that plants obtain appropriate hydration without overwatering. Grouping plants with comparable water requires with each other can streamline Irrigation efforts and promote performance. By executing these methods, garden enthusiasts can boost their watering techniques and assistance sustainable garden management.
